Forged in the Fire
For Ismael Valdez, failure was never an option. Whether it was losing his mother at an early age, being orphaned, or struggling to get ahead after immigrating to the United States, he’s never once let those things be an excuse. Ken Goodrich is no different. What sets these two apart is that regardless of the circumstances, they push forward and use adversity to propel themselves and their businesses to greater heights.
Ismael remembers his father drilling into him and his brothers that if they were going to do something, they were going to do it right. Not only that, they were going to be the best at it. That’s the kind of mindset you need to dominate. Do you have that fire?

No Excuses. Just Results
When you listen to KG and Ismael speak, you can tell that what they share is a mindset that allows them to tackle any problem and see it as an opportunity. While Ken prefers to ignore the competition and do things his way and Ismael prefers to focus on learning from his competition, they both have a shared determination that elevates their results despite a difference in methodologies.
